It’s fairly rare for a celebrity to take action over a domain name (considering how many celebrities and pseudo celebs there are these days).

Exceptions:

1. They are not able to secure the .com for their planned official fan site.
2. The site is being used in a way that their management believes will damage their career.
3. The usage is offensive or derogatory in fashion.


Even when a celebrity does take action against someone it’s usually an established one which will likely give anyone holding one of these domains a considerable amount of time.
